No matter how busy your December may be, you’re not likely to miss Christmas. But how do we prepare our hearts for Christmas amidst the busy and commercialised season to not miss one of the most beautiful things about Christmas – a season to generously give.
In our culture, we’re far more focused on getting than giving. Children craft Christmas wish lists filled with what they hope to receive – not what they hope to give. Don’t misunderstand me, there’s nothing wrong with presents – I like receiving them as much as anyone. But Jesus and Paul remind us that the joy of receiving simply cannot compare to the joy of giving (Acts 20:35).
While we enjoy buying presents for others, far too often our mindset becomes one of exchanging gifts rather than giving them. But what if you gave a gift where the only exchange that happened was the joy you received of giving a truly meaningful gift.
Like giving a gift of clean drinking water… or providing food to someone who would otherwise go hungry… or sharing what you have with someone the world overlooks… or choosing to go without so someone else can have what they truly need – that is a blessing deeper than any gift you could ever receive.
And this is where leadership comes in. Great leaders go first. They set the tone. They model generosity not as an occasional act, but as a way of life. When leaders give, others follow. Their generosity becomes contagious, shaping a culture that reflects the heart of God.
John 3:16 says, “For God so loved the world He gave…”
At Christmas, God didn’t exchange – He gave. As leaders, may we reflect His example. Enjoy the gifts you receive but never forget: the greatest joy comes from leading with a generous heart.
